What is a Fifth Wheel?


A fifth wheel is a type of trailer that attaches to a special hitch mounted in the bed of a pickup truck. This design allows for a greater weight capacity than traditional bumper-pull trailers, making them a popular choice among those who enjoy camping, traveling, or living in RVs. Unlike bumper pull trailers, fifth wheels provide better stability, reduced sway, and improved maneuverability.


Why Do You Need to Know the Weight?


Understanding the weight of your fifth wheel trailer is vital for several reasons


1. Towing Capacity Every vehicle has a specified towing capacity. Exceeding this limit can strain your vehicle, leading to potential mechanical failures and safety risks on the road. By consulting the fifth wheel weight chart, you can ensure that your trailer falls within the safe towing limits of your truck.


2. Weight Distribution Proper weight distribution is essential for safe towing. A chart will help you understand the trailer's gross weight, tongue weight, and pin weight. This data will allow you to adjust the load accordingly for better balance and control.


3. Legal Compliance Different states have varying regulations regarding vehicle and towing weights. Knowing your trailer's weight will help you comply with local laws and avoid fines or penalties.


4. Safety Overloaded trailers can result in blowouts or difficulties in braking and steering. A fifth wheel weight chart provides insight into the weights that are safe for travel, helping ensure your journey is safe for you and others on the road.


Interpreting the Fifth Wheel Weight Chart


When looking at a fifth wheel weight chart, you will typically find various terms associated with trailer weights

-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) This is the maximum weight a trailer is rated to safely carry, including all cargo. - Unloaded Vehicle Weight (UVW) This is the weight of the trailer without any cargo or fluids (except for a full tank of propane).


- Cargo Carrying Capacity (CCC) This reflects how much weight you can load into the trailer without exceeding the GVWR.


- Pin Weight For fifth wheel trailers, this is the weight transferred to the truck's hitch. It typically ranges from 15% to 25% of the trailer's total weight.


Selecting the Best Fifth Wheel for Your Needs


When choosing the right fifth wheel trailer, consider the following factors


1. Towing Vehicle Make sure your pickup truck is equipped with a hitch that can handle the weight of the trailer you are considering. Check your truck’s manufacturer guidelines for towing capacity.


2. Type of Travel Choose a fifth wheel that suits your travel style. If you plan to go off-grid, consider lighter models, while those seeking comfort for long trips may prefer larger, heavier units.


3. Family Size The number of people traveling will affect the size and weight of the trailer you need. Larger units can accommodate more beds but can also weigh significantly more.


4. Budget Weight impacts not only the purchase price but also maintenance and operation costs, such as fuel efficiency.
